Nestled in the tranquil depths of Hyogo Prefecture's Mikata-gun, Yatagawa Campsite offers a serene escape alongside the crystal-clear Yatagawa River. This conveniently located campsite, adjacent to a fully-stocked Michi-no-eki, is perfect for both first-time campers and families seeking a hassle-free outdoor adventure. Its expansive free sites are ideal for group camping, and a unique dog-friendly policy allows your canine companions to roam off-leash freely. With the river just a 30-second stroll away for refreshing dips and excellent facilities like hot showers and heated toilets, you can enjoy everything from spring's vibrant greens to autumn's fiery foliage in comfort and ease.

Harima CASAGOYA offers a truly unique camping experience, built around a beautifully renovated 100-year-old traditional Japanese house nestled against an expansive 8000㎡ private mountain. Here, you can immerse yourself in the rich traditions of Japan with an authentic irori hearth, a cozy wood-burning stove fueled by the mountain's timber, and serene verandas, all while enjoying modern amenities in the kitchen and bathrooms. Imagine harvesting fresh bamboo shoots, wild vegetables, and shiitake mushrooms directly from your backyard, then cooking your bounty over the irori for an unforgettable meal. With future plans for treehouses and dedicated campsites, it promises large-scale outdoor adventures unavailable in urban settings. This is the perfect blend of slow living and convenient access, inviting you to discover the joys of a "modern countryside" lifestyle throughout all four seasons.

Nestled in the serene Mineyama Highlands villa area within Hyogo Prefecture's Shiso City, STAR RESORT offers a secluded escape embraced by a national park. This unique destination provides a variety of stays, from a charming Scandinavian-style log house perfect for families and friends (including furry ones!) to glamping tents and even solo camping sites. Imagine waking up to breathtaking sea of clouds from the open deck, or gazing at a sky full of stars; the summer here is also a refreshing 5-10°C cooler than Osaka. With rock climbing, swings, and even a dog run, it's an ideal spot for an active retreat, all conveniently located just 1.5 to 2 hours from Osaka by car.

Nestled by the Ibi fishing port in Minamiawaji City, Ibi Uzushio Village offers a breathtaking auto-camp experience with panoramic views of the Naruto Strait. Imagine witnessing spectacular sunsets over the sea, a truly unforgettable sight, especially from April to October. This versatile campsite caters to all, from families enjoying the summer beach (open July-August) to solo adventurers and romantic getaways, boasting powered sites, bath facilities, and firewood sales. Its convenient location, just a short drive from Awajishima Minami IC, makes it an easily accessible escape into nature's embrace.
